"Rules of Engagement" star David Spade became a daddy.
The comedian actor who became famous while starring in "Saturday Night Live" is first-time father of a baby girl born to Playboy Playmate Jillian Grace. The 22-year-old model gave birth last week, the actor’s rep confirmed.
The two now parents were in very close contact during Jillian’s pregnancy and 45-year-old Spade intends to visit her as soon as he gets the first break from shooting “Rules of Engagement,” according publicist Meredith O'Sullivanto quoted by People magazine.
Spade, who is 23 years older than the mother of his first baby, acknowledged that he got involved with the beautiful Miss March 2005, but didn’t give any details regarding her pregnancy. In early 2008, Jillian revealed that she was pregnant with the comedian, but Spade said nothing about his role in the whole business.
"If it is true that I am the father of her child, then I will accept responsibility," was all Spade said about it then, E! News reported.
The baby girl was born on August 26 in Missouri, but her name wasn’t revealed.
David Spade’s good sense of humor lured other beauties such as Heather Locklear, Lara Flynn Boyle, Krista Allen and Julie Bowen.
Spade made his first step on the fame carpet in the 90s as a cast member on “Saturday Night Live.” He also had successful roles in “8 Simple Rules,” “Black Sheep,” “Lost & Found,” and “Dickie Roberts: Former Child Star.”
